Simple way to deal with this situation: instigator = suspension.

Two goons wanna have a staged "fight"? Hand out instigators to both of em, give both of them suspensions. Increase suspension based on repeat offenses.

I'm fine with the impassioned "standing up for your teammate" fight, but there HAS to be a cost associated with it, and a 2 min minor is not even remotely close to being sufficient (and that's when the referees get it correctly).

I'm tired of being forced to sit through boring staged fights where the two "goons" give each other pats on the head afterwards. That isn't hockey.

I'm tired of seeing a great, hard check on a player result in retaliation or a fight. That isn't hockey.

I'm also tired of seeing similar positions to mine characterized as "soccer mom". I want to see hard hitting, fast paced physical hockey. I don't want to see a bunch of prima-donnas dropping the gloves the moment they get checked into the boards or stripped of the puck. Increase the cost for behaviour like this and the game will get better.
